Common Chamberlain Garage Door Problems We Solve in Milford

  • Noisy or binding chain drive on Chamberlain B970/B550 units. Salt air off Long Island Sound corrodes the steel rail joints on Chamberlain chain-drive systems, especially in Woodmont and the Walnut Beach corridor. We hear the grinding before we see the rust — and we stock OEM replacement drives plus stainless hardware that won’t seize again in three seasons.
  • False obstruction triggers on Chamberlain C870 safety sensors. Post-Sandy raised foundations throughout Milford’s coastal flood zones often leave under 12 inches of headroom. Standard Chamberlain sensor bracket placement hits framing or gets knocked by stored gear. We relocate and rewire these brackets to eliminate phantom stops — a factory-authorized tech following the manual would walk away stumped.
  • Erratic opener response after Nor’easter moisture exposure. Ground-level doors in Gulf Beach and along the FEMA flood zone take wind-driven rain straight to the logic board housing. Chamberlain’s board can fail intermittently even after surface drying; we test for latent corrosion and replace with sealed OEM units when the damage is done.
  • Seized cable drums and premature spring failure. In Milford’s coastal sections, we’ve replaced Chamberlain-system springs at 5–7 years instead of the rated 10-plus. The salt never sleeps. We quote galvanized or stainless cable drum kits upfront — standard practice here, unnecessary a few miles north in Orange.
  • Smart opener connectivity drops in converted bungalows. Many Walnut Beach and Woodmont homes started as summer cottages with aluminum wiring or subpanels that don’t play nice with Chamberlain’s MyQ draw. We diagnose the electrical environment before recommending a smart upgrade, not after.

Chamberlain Service in Milford: What Local Conditions Mean for Your Equipment

Milford’s miles of Long Island Sound shoreline — running through densely residential coastal neighborhoods like Woodmont and the Walnut Beach/Gulf Beach corridor — expose garage door springs, cables, tracks, and bottom brackets to persistent salt air that corrodes metal hardware far faster than it would in neighboring inland cities like Shelton or Derby. For Chamberlain owners in Orange and inland towns, this means the factory-standard steel chain-drive rail and zinc-plated springs that hold up fine there start failing early here. We see it constantly: a Chamberlain B970 that ran whisper-quiet in Shelton grinds and binds in Woodmont within five years because the rail joints have oxidized. Additionally, post-Hurricane Sandy reconstruction elevated many coastal Milford homes on raised foundations or pilings, creating non-standard headroom and sideroom configurations that require site-specific spring calculations and track adjustments beyond typical residential installs. A Chamberlain C870 installed to factory specs on a raised foundation in Gulf Beach will throw false obstruction codes until someone repositions those sensors by hand — which is exactly what Jeffrey does, because he’s the one on the ladder.

In Milford’s Walnut Beach section, many converted summer bungalows have non-standard 8-foot-wide, 6-foot-8-inch-tall rough openings that require custom-ordered Chamberlain door sections and specially cut tracks — a configuration rare even in neighboring coastal towns like West Haven. We’ve sourced these enough times to know the lead times and the workarounds. Whatever brand you have, we figure it out.

Chamberlain Models & Products We Service in Milford

We work on the full Chamberlain residential line: the belt-drive B970 and B550 workhorses, the chain-drive C870, and the wired keypad series. For opener repairs, we use genuine Chamberlain OEM parts — logic boards, chain drives, belt assemblies, safety sensors — because compatibility matters and aftermarket opener electronics cause callbacks. For springs, cables, and drums in Milford’s coastal zones, we spec high-grade galvanized or stainless aftermarket hardware. Factory-standard zinc plating doesn’t survive the salt air here; we’d rather explain that once than return in two years.

Our Milford stock includes common Chamberlain failure items for fast turnaround: replacement chain drives, belt assemblies, logic boards for the B970/C870 families, and stainless cable drum kits sized for the non-standard lifts we see on raised foundations. Smart opener upgrades are a growing request — we evaluate your WiFi environment and electrical panel first, because a MyQ-enabled B970 won’t help you if your bungalow’s aluminum wiring can’t sustain the draw.

Chamberlain Service Pricing in Milford

Service Price Range
Spring Repair $180–$340
Cable Repair $130–$250
Opener Repair $120–$320
Opener Installation $250–$550
Panel Replacement $250–$500
Track Realignment $120–$240
Roller Replacement $110–$220
New Door Installation $700–$2,200
General Garage Door Repair $150–$600

What drives cost up or down: accessibility of your opener (vaulted ceilings in raised ranches take longer), whether we need stainless hardware for coastal exposure, and if your framing requires custom track cuts.
